Windows Redstone 5 New Build Features

You can download the preview and enjoy the new features. Apart from crashes and some display errors the other new features include BitLocker working in a proper way as well as PDFs opening properly in the Edge browser.

Here is a summary of all the updates in the new Redstone 5 build as compiled by Winfuture.

  • Fixed an issue where entering in the Microsoft Edge URL bar immediately after opening a new tab could cause the letters to appear in an unexpected order.
  • Fixed a problem opening local .html or .pdf files (double-click, right-click> open), Microsoft Edge does not render the loaded content if Microsoft Edge was not already running before opening the file.
  • Fixed an issue where PDFs displayed with Microsoft Edge would be reduced after refreshing the page if DPI scaling> 100% was used.
  • Fixed an issue that could cause Microsoft Edge to crash if certain extensions were disabled.
  • Fixed an issue that caused Task Manager to not display the title of the application in the process name for open Visual Studio projects.
  • Fixed an issue that caused the UAC dialog to appear incorrectly in recent flights.
  • Fixed an issue that caused certain devices with BitLocker to unexpectedly boot into BitLocker recovery in the most recent flights.
  • Fixed an issue where the emoji panel was closed after an accent was entered in certain languages.
  • Fixed an issue that caused the focus to be lost after the Action Center was closed with WIN + A.
